FRIDAY TIP: Using Apertures to Control the Depth of Field

Image
Depth of field in the term used to describe the distance in front of and behind a focus point that appears sharp in the image.  This is controlled by focal length of a lens and the aperture used.   A shallow depth of field pulls the viewers attention to the part of the image the photographer has chosen to focus on.  A large depth of field makes sure that most, if not all, of an image is in focus. The following two images, taken using a Fuji X-Pro1 and Fujinon 14mm f2.8R demonstrate how the use of a wide aperture (f2.8) and a small aperture (f11) alters the depth of field. Snowdrops in the Vale - Depth of Field Explained

Image
Depth of field is a term that is used in photography that describes the amount of distance between the nearest and farthest objects that appear in acceptably sharp focus in a photograph. Depth of field is referred to a 'DoF' in some camera manuals or texts. Depth of field is controlled by the aperture setting.  A small aperture (high 'f' number - ie f22) will give a large depth of field or a wider area of sharp focus and a large aperture (low 'f' number - ie f4) will give a small depth of field or a narrower area of sharp focus. The images below, of Snowdrops in the Vale of Belvoir, were taken on a Nikon D800 with a 60mm f2.8 AF-D micro lens and mounted on a sturdy tripod.  The first image was taken at f7.1 and the focus point was the snowdrop on the left of the image.  As you can see the DoF is very shallow, with just the front Snowdrop in focus.  In fact the DoF is so shallow not all of the flower head is perfectly sharp.
